Situated near Stanwood, Lynden is a charming community with a rich history in Whatcom County.
Early Inhabitants: Before the arrival of the first settlers, the area was home to a Nooksack Indian village with abundant indigenous culture and heritage.WanderWisdom+3Whatcom Local+3Wikipedia+3
Settlement and Growth: Founded in the late 19th century by Holden and Phoebe Judson, Lynden quickly became a bustling community. By 1889, it was replete with various businesses including general stores, bakeries and newspaper s.Wikipedia+7HistoryLink+7Lynden+7
Dutch Influence: In the first and second generations of Dutch immigrants to settle in Lynden in the early 20th century, survivors merged with American settler cities of Lynden to form an entirely new cultural environment enclosed within its own architectural expression. This city, as a direct legacy of that act and event, continues today to maintain its own special Dutch air–evidenced through windmills, “Holland Village” shop fronts and town pieces, and in particular the annual festival, Klompin Days; named after a particular wooden clog so characteristic of Dutch shoe wearers.HistoryLink+1WanderWisdom+1
Modern Day Lynden: Now the second largest city in Whatcom County, Lynden is known for strong community values that reflect its diverse history and heritage. It is also home of the annual Northwest Washington Fair.HollyMelody+2Wikipedia+2Whatcom Local+2

Stanwood has a rich history marked by early settlement, industrial growth, and cultural development. Each phase has shaped its community and environment.
The early settlement of Stanwood dates from the 1860s. Pioneers and homesteaders drew here by stories of regional resources and the fertile land made possible a number of settlements along Stillaguamish River delta. Most of the first colonists originated from Scandinavia, and in particular Norway. But they were joined by others from throughout Europe who brought agricultural skills and strong values for community building with them. The river served as a transportation artery and avenue for trade from the beginning, and this pattern of economic advance drew more new settlers into Stanwood and its vicinity.
In the 1870s and 1880s, Stanwood was already a major port on the river. Steamboats were constantly coming and going from the town in order to deliver goods and people.
Stanwood’s industrial development was closely tied to its geographical location and natural environment. From the late nineteenth century to the early twentieth century, timber was the dominant industry. Stanwood’s dense forests provided an ample amount of raw material for logging operations, and on of several sawmills and lumber yards were established in the area. With the opening of the country’s first commercial harvesting of timber West of Boston this town became a center for film processing. Logging created not only employment, but also supported related industries like boat-building and paper milling.
Agriculture also thrived. Dairy farming and crop cultivation became major sources of livelihood for the local people.
The initial settlers of Stanwood, and primarily those of Scandinavian ancestry, also had an important influence on the town’s social and cultural makeup. The Norwegian and Swedish immigrants who came here had brought with them a strong sense of community, the ability to strive continuously for success, and cultural practices that still thrive today. Each year events like the Stanwood-Camano Community Fair and various Viking-themed festivals are reminders of this glorious past and encourage local pride in traditions ranging from the Scandinavian dances performed at these maritime gatherings is evidence of their legacy to this day.
Religious institutions were important in the formation of Stanwood’s social landscape. Lutheran churches were among the first established and not only became spiritual centers but also meeting places for social as well as educational activities.
